Rare gilded bronze medallion circa 1880's awarded for merit by the Volunteer League of the British Empire where all ranks of the Rifle Volunteers could be members. Their headquarters was at 2 Southampton Street the Strand, London. Being gilt bronze it was awarded to NCO's or junior officers. It is in excellent condition showing slight wear to the gilt on the high points and comes in its original case of issue.The medallion measures 1.75 inches in diameter.
